2026, 새로운 도약을 시작합니다.

장바구니 세션 확인

test 라는 아이디로 로그인 하여 상품을 장바구니에 담았습니다.

od_id가 111111 로 담겼습니다.

그 후 다른 상품 상세페이지에서 한참이 지나 세션이 끊긴 상태에서

상품을 담는다면 od_id 가 새롭게 담겨지나요 ?

아니면 od_id가 111111 로 담기나요 ?

로그인 후 장바구니에 담긴 상품을 구매하였는데

같은 od_id 인데 cart 테이블에서 하나의 상품에는 mb_id 가 없이 주문이 되었습니다

답변 3개

장바구니 세션이 끊기면 생성시 새로 코드를 만들어서 달라집니다.

로그인 후 평가할 수 있습니다

댓글을 작성하려면 로그인이 필요합니다.

od_id 가 12345 로 g5_shop_cart 에 5개의 상품이 들어가있고

해당 제품을 구매를 하였습니다 g5_shop_order 에서도 od_id 는 12345 입니다.

근데 주문한 od_id가 12345인 제품을 g5_shop_cart 에서 확인해보니

4개의 상품은 mb_id 가 AAA 로 들어가있는데 하나의 상품은 공란으로 들어가있습니다.

어떠한 경우에 이렇게 들어가는지 알 수 있을까요 ?

로그인 후 평가할 수 있습니다

답변에 대한 댓글 2개

공란이 들어갈수없습니다 뭔가 버그가 있는거 같습니다.
비회원으로 주문시 mb_id 가 공란으로 들어가지 않나요 ?
혹시 상품 상세화면에 오래 머물러있다가 해당 상품을 담았을떄
세션이 끊긴 상태로 cartupdate.php 에서 처리하게 되면
od_id는 기존의 값을 물고 있는지가 궁금한것입니다.

댓글을 작성하려면 로그인이 필요합니다.

세션 끊어지면 장바구니 비워 있는거라서 새로 담아야됩니다.

로그인 후 평가할 수 있습니다

댓글을 작성하려면 로그인이 필요합니다.

답변을 작성하려면 로그인이 필요합니다.

로그인
🐛 버그신고